Verimatrix Reinforces DVB CA Capability with
Comvenient Acquisition
Team from Comvenient Adds Strength and Depth to VCAS Solution Family for a New Approach to DVB CA
Verimatrix is proud to announce the acquisition of Comvenient GmbH, a premiere producer of DVB conditional access (CA) technology. Verimatrix and Comvenient have been long-term partners in the development of the Verimatrix Video Content Authority System (VCAS™) for DVB security solution, and the acquisition greatly expands the company's ability to penetrate this market with an innovative approach to traditional CA technologies for digital TV operators around the globe. The new relationship provides the framework for the seamless integration and marketing of Comvenient's technology and expertise within Verimatrix solutions.
Comvenient has a distinguished record in the industry and has supplied advanced DVB conditional access systems to more than 100 operators since the company was formed in 2003. The company entered a strategic relationship with Verimatrix in November of 2008 to generate cross product synergies. Verimatrix is now able to market an expanded range of DVB security solutions within the VCAS family, with the goal of providing secure and scalable solutions for a wide range of platforms. DVB operators will have access to the fullest range of potential secure client devices from a single security head-end to support their business objectives, including new breeds of cardless set-top boxes (STBs), hybrid IPTV STBs and hybrid Internet TV devices. The combination of the Verimatrix widely adopted solutions for IP based content protection and Comvenient's long term expertise in the DVB sector places the combined company in the forefront of future technology development. The combined company will utilize the existing Comvenient headquarters in Munich as the Verimatrix high security development and support center.
